According to the co-writer and longtime band member Bob Gaudio, the song was originally set in 1933 with the title "December 5th, 1933," and celebrated the repeal of Prohibition. Lead singer Frankie Valli was not  thrilled about the lyrics - and  objected to parts of the melody - so Gaudio redid the words.  It ended up being a nostalgic love song.

TRIVIA:
The lead singer on the first verse was their drummer Gerri Polci - Frankie Valli comes in on the second verse.
